This collection from bareMinerals gives me a little bit of a vacation-feel, the Wanderlust Tropics Collection. While this is a 6-piece color collection, I am missing two of the pieces. It’s because this is an editorial sample, so no worries! Yours from Sephora should be A-OKAY!

What’s included with a colorful paisley-printed travel bag:

  • Prime Time Primer Shadow in Coral Reef (gilded soft apricot-coral)
  • Wild Orchid Eyecolor (sparkling violet)
  • Round The Clock Waterproof Eyeliner in 6 PM (jeweled violet) NOT PICTURED
  • Faux Tan Matte All-Over Face Color (sun-kissed matte) NOT PICTURED
  • Tropical Radiance All-Over Face Color (soft luminous coral)
  • Double-Ended Natural Lipgloss in Papaya Smoothie (peach shimmer) & Pink Guava (sheer fuchsia)

Wanderlust Tropics Collection, Sephora Exclusive, Limited Edition, $49

Wild Orchid Eyecolor, Tropical Radiance All-Over Face Color

Wild Orchid Eyecolor

This is an absolutely captivating eyecolor. If you have even the slightest hint of green in your eyes, it will really make them come alive! This was a little bold in my crease, even though it blends beautifully like the other loose bareMinerals eyeshadows. So what I opted to do, was wear this as a liner (slightly wet, with a liner brush). This does have a very fine glimmer to it, so if you look for more mattes, this might not be for you. My set was missing its liner, so it was pretty convenient for me! I wore the Prime Time Primer Shadow in Coral Reef as my actual shadow, and they paired up just perfectly.

Tropical Radiance All-Over Face Color

What a gorgeous warm face color, right? I wore this as a blush with no problem, and didn’t find it to be too glittery or shimmery in any way. It can be used as a shadow, along the bridge of your nose for a little warmth, and you can also pop a little bit into your lipgloss, so it’s a versatile piece!

Prime Time Primer Shadow in Coral Reef

This product is AMAZING. I’m the person with hooded lids that most primers don’t stand a chance against. Not so with the Prime Time Primer Shadows! I love that this is a slightly warm apricot (but not too warm), and still looks good on cooler complexions. In fact, that was probably my biggest A-HA! moment about the Wanderlust Tropics Collection. All skin tones should look great with this color configuration. If you told me it didn’t work out for you, I would honestly be surprised!

Dual-end lip gloss has brush applicator

Okay, my lovely ladies of BE. This is coming from a place of love; but the brushes on both of the glosses are having an identity crisis. It’s a little frustrating, considering I don’t have a problem like this with my individual, full-size shades of Natural Lipgloss. So this component might need some tweaking. It could even be the lip of the tube that’s bending the bristles—and not the brush itself. Just something to think about!

The glosses themselves are great. I have to say that my favorite shade is definitely the Pink Guava, it didn’t feel too gummy either. I went to a meeting, spoke for over an hour, and had a beverage and snack. Then, I walked out and looked in my rear-view mirror in the car when I got in, and I STILL had pink gloss on. For people who don’t have very pigmented lips, the Papaya Smoothie could look a little pale and frosty. Just something to think about!

Bottom Line…

We all know that I’m a long-time BE fan in general, so it’s very rare that something doesn’t make me happy. (Especially if it’s a color collection.) So far, of all the Wanderlust collections (there are three others which I’ll cover soon), I have to say that Tropics lured me in its direction the hardest. If my biggest complaint however, is that the bristles on the lipglosses go a little wayward—we’re in pretty good shape! I dig that the fabric on the cosmetic bag is covered, that way I can wipe off all of the makeup smudges I am sure to get on it!
